<p>Jaunpur (UP): Defence Minister <a href="https://www.deccanherald.com/tags/rajnath-singh">Rajnath Singh</a> on Sunday described Pakistan-occupied Kashmir as the "crown jewel of India" and asserted that Jammu and Kashmir was incomplete without it.</p>.<p>The senior BJP leader also accused Pakistan of continuing its conspiracy to foster terrorism in Jammu and Kashmir.</p>.<p>Singh was speaking to reporters in the Nizamuddinpur village of Jaunpur district, where he attended a ceremonial event at the home of senior BJP leader Jagat Narayan Dubey.</p>.<p>"It (Pakistan-occupied Kashmir) is the crown jewel of India and Jammu and Kashmir is incomplete without it," he said.</p>.<p>"For Pakistan, the Kashmir occupied by it is nothing more than a foreign territory being used to promote terrorism and anti-India propaganda. Terror camps and launch pads there (Pakistan-occupied Kashmir) should be dismantled or it will face an appropriate response," Singh added.</p>.India's offensive and defensive responses need to be strengthened, says Rajnath Singh.<p>The defence minister also hit out at Pakistani leader Anwar-ul-Haq over his alleged anti-India rhetoric.</p>.<p>"Pakistan is trying to provoke people against India on religious grounds while oppressing citizens there," he said.</p>.<p>He also claimed that India had emerged as the world's largest digital economy under Prime Minister Narendra Modi's leadership.</p>.<p>India, which now has the highest number of 5G users, is on track to becoming a developed nation by 2047, Singh asserted.</p>.<p>"Today, when India speaks, the world listens attentively. Our scientists are manufacturing defence equipment on Indian soil and exporting those to other nations. Moreover, 1.30 lakh start-ups are operational in the country," the defence minister said.</p>.<p>Singh urged youngsters to delve deep into India's history and said it reflected the country's accomplishments across domains. </p>
